Quick Facts — Countryside CDP

What is the median household income in Countryside CDP?
The median household income in Countryside CDP is $143,229 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Countryside CDP?
The poverty rate in Countryside CDP is 2.6%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Countryside CDP?
$567,600 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Countryside CDP?
The median gross rent in Countryside CDP is $2,313 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Countryside CDP residents have a college degree?
61.8% of adults in Countryside CDP h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
